Abstract

This work presents the Admissibility Lifecycle within the Paton System as a structural diagram describing system existence from emergence through stability motion control collapse and post-collapse outcomes. Systems enter admissible space through admissibility and reachability conditions and evolve according to admissibility margin viability gradients curvature and admissible trajectories. Control mechanisms act to preserve admissibility until structural thresholds are reached. Collapse occurs when admissibility can no longer be maintained leading to post-collapse dynamics and three distinct outcomes: system re-entry successor formation or terminal collapse. This diagram provides a domain independent visual representation of the full system lifecycle without modifying underlying governing equations.
